Syrian Gov't forces extend rule over 95 percent of Aleppo city

FNA- Syrian Army troops and popular forces are now in control of over 95 percent of Eastern Aleppo, the Russian Peace Coordination Center in Syria announced on Monday, while other sources said the army has 98 percent of the city under its control.

"Over the past 24 hours, the Syrian armed forces have liberated three districts of the Eastern part of Aleppo. Thus, over 95 percent of the territory of Aleppo is under government control," the Russian center said in a statement, adding that terrorists are squeezed now in a very small area.

In the meantime, the Arabic language Elam al-Harbi news website disclosed that the army and popular forces have tightened siege on militant in Southeastern Aleppo, cornering terrorists of Jeish al-Fatah in only five sq/km that is only two percent of Aleppo city's total area.

Reports said earlier today that the army troops and popular forces managed to drive Jeish al-Fatah coalition of terrorist groups out of their last positions in Southeastern Aleppo, squeezing the militants in a very small area with no way out.

The army soldiers and the Lebanese Hezbollah combatants continued their advances against Jeish al-Fatah and won back the neighborhoods of Karama al-Da'ada, al-Ferdows, al-Shahedin, Karam al-Afandi and al-Sharif Citadel and moved towards the neighborhoods of al-Kelaseh, Bostan al-Qasr (Bustan al-Kaser) and Souq (Bazaar) al-Haal, tightening siege on the militants in the battlefields.

The pro-government forces are chasing and hunting the militants that have preferred to flee towards the neighborhoods of al-Sukri, al-Mash'had, al-Ameriyeh and al-Ansari.

The army's engineering units, for their part, are defusing bombs and landmines planed by the terrorists in the streets of the newly-liberated districts and neighborhoods.

The army men and popular forces fortified their positions in the district of Sheikh Saeed and carried out fresh offensive against terrorists' defense lines in Karam al-Nazha neighborhood, winning back part of this neighborhood.

The army soldiers also took back control over a neighborhood between the district of al-Salehin and al-Hajj bridge Northwest of al-Ferdows and managed to approach al-Hajj square near the bridge.

If the army captures al-Hajj bridge militants in al-Kelaseh neighborhood will be besieged from the South.
